From: Simon McVittie <smcv@debian.org>
Date: Mon, 7 Mar 2022 19:52:25 +0000
Subject: test-prune: Read to the end of cut(1) output
If we use head(1) to take only the first two lines, then cut(1) and
earlier pipeline entries are killed by SIGPIPE (if they have not already
terminated), and that's flagged as an error under `set -o pipefail`.
Use an equivalent sed command to take exactly the second line, but
without SIGPIPE.
